Google Translate: Pros and Cons
Google Translate is a highly popular online translation tools. It supports over 100 languages and is available on smart devices. It’s ideal for quick translations, but not recommended for medical content.
Top Benefits
- Fast and easy to use
- Extensive language database
- Offline mode available
Disadvantages of Google Translate
- Mistranslation risks
- No emotional context
- Insecure for sensitive data
Pros and Cons of Web-Based Translators
Online translation makes communication across languages more accessible. You can now communicate across borders in real-time. But while these tools are handy, over-reliance can lead to errors.
Ideal Use Cases
Online translators are perfect for:
- Travel communication
- Reading product reviews
- Translating social media posts
When to Avoid Online Translators
Online tools should be avoided when:
- Accuracy is critical
- Dealing with contracts or medical texts
- Precision is non-negotiable
